ITSI was one of 20 companies that were awarded HERC prime contracts. The prime contractors will share in project awards totaling up to $15 billion ($6 billion base amount) through the HERC contract. The HERC contracts represent the next major series of contract vehicles that the AFCEE will use to meet the long-term requirements of the Air Force, the Department of Defense (DoD), and other federal agencies. ITSI is a worldwide full-service infrastructure construction, engineering, and remediation services company. ITSI has 28 offices worldwide and provides clients with innovative and proven techniques to solve construction and environmental needs in the areas of engineering design, civil construction, remediation, and decontamination/decommissioning services. Established in 1994, ITSI is a financially strong business with estimated 2006 revenues of over $ 150 million.
